Concerned about links between electromagnetic fields and cancer, 190 scientists from 39 nations are calling for protective guidelines governing exposure.
A new test available for $119 allows tap water, urine and breast-milk testing for levels of the controversial Roundup pesticide commonly found in food and farm water run-offs.
Twenty minutes a day of abdominal massage relieved chronic constipation in 87 percent of children participating in a University of Washington study.
Adults with poor cholesterol that nibbled on 1.5 ounces of shelled pistachios a day for three months raised their HDL “good cholesterol” levels and reduced arterial stiffness.
